Technical Parameters of STMicroelectronics LEOAD128PT-D
| Parameter | Specification |
|---|---|
| Function | 128-channel LED driver with PWM dimming for multi-LED brightness control and switching |
| Number of LED Channels | 128 independent, addressable LED channels |
| Supply Voltage Range | 2.5V to 5.5V DC (compatible with 3.3V/5V lighting control systems) |
| Standby Current (Typ) | 0.6??A (at 3.3V supply, all LEDs off) |
| Active Current (Typ) | 3.2mA (at 3.3V supply, 50% LEDs active, 50% PWM duty cycle) |
| Per-Channel Max Drive Current | 20mA (constant current regulation) |
| PWM Dimming Range | 0?C100% (12-bit resolution for smooth brightness adjustment) |
| Input Interface | I2C serial interface (compatible with TTL/CMOS logic levels) |
| Operating Temperature Range | -40??C to +125??C (extended industrial/outdoor temperature grade) |
| Package Type | TSSOP38 (38-pin Thin Shrink Small Outline Package), 14.0mm x 7.5mm x 1.2mm dimensions (surface-mount, 0.5mm pin spacing) |
| Protection Features | Over-current protection, thermal shutdown, LED open/short detection |
| Compliance | RoHS 2 compliant, ISO 9001 certified, IEC 61000-6-2 |
